This is a remote role that may be hired in several markets across the United States.
**Remote with ability to travel to Raleigh, North Carolina, Phoenix, Arizona or Morristown, New Jersey, on an as needed basis.
This position supports Information Security and Cyber Threat management programs within the Bank at a complex level of ability. Evaluates the Bank's networks and systems to identify technical security gaps or deficiencies within the Identity and Access Management principles. Develops process improvements and technical solutions that address the identified gaps or deficiencies. Facilitates the defense of the organization's information security and technological architecture through ongoing reporting and escalation of emerging threats. Assists management with special projects and oversees less experienced associates in the work group.

Bachelor's Degree and 6 years of experience in Information Security OR High School Diploma or GED and 10 years of experience in Information Security
Preferred Skill(s):
- IT or Cybersecurity experience in a heavily regulatory organization, preferably banking.
- An understanding of NIST and COBIT frameworks
- General understanding of application security management hosted on various platforms (i.e. Mainframe, Windows, Linux/Unix, Oracle, Windows, DB2, Cloud Technologies, etc).
- Basic programming, data analytics and reporting skills desired but not required

The base pay for this position is generally between $120,000 and $155,000. Actual starting base pay will be determined based on skills, experience, location, and other non-discriminatory factors permitted by law. For some roles, total compensation may also include variable incentives, bonuses, benefits, and/or other awards as outlined in the offer of employment.
